Welcome to Inclusive Stories, a podcast created for parents raising Autistic, ADHD, and all neurodivergent children, especially those navigating this journey as Black and ethnic minority families. My name is Brooklyn, a proud mum, disability advocate, author, and tea-loving Londoner raising two beautiful boys on the autism spectrum. This podcast was born out of my lived experience, fighting for support, battling cultural stigma, and learning to advocate fiercely for my sons in systems that weren’t built with them in mind. I know what it feels like to be dismissed, overlooked, or called “too much” just for asking for what your child needs. That’s why Inclusive Stories exists: To give our stories space. To make sure no parent feels like they are walking this road alone. In each episode, I open up about the real-life challenges and joys of raising neurodivergent children, and I sit down with other parents, educators, experts, and advocates to share tools, insights, and truths that are often left out of the conversation. We talk about EHCPs. We talk about meltdowns. We talk about identity, intersectionality, and love. And yes—we talk about the messy, funny, powerful in-between moments too. 🌙 Inclusive Stories After Dark For the quiet moments. The tired hearts. The joy you almost forgot was yours. Inclusive Stories After Dark is our softer side, designed to soothe, uplift, and honour SEND parents. These 10–20 minute evening episodes are where I talk to you, I share calming stories, affirmations, real-life giggles, and our signature “Ask Brooklyn” segment (which gets a little cheeky sometimes, because we need that too). It’s not about fixing anything. It’s about resting, breathing, and remembering yourself again. Because you, friend, are holding so much. And you deserve a space where someone holds you, too.     Parenting Multiple Autistic Children with Sua Kyei

    What does it mean to raise more than one autistic child, while also navigating cultural expectations, diagnosis journeys, and a system that does not always see us? In this powerful episode of Inclusive Stories, Brooklyn sits down with Sua, a British legal practitioner and proud mum of three daughters, two of whom are autistic. Together, they explore the layered, emotional, and transformative experience of parenting multiple neurodivergent children.
